A Place that Touches the Stars

An ideal destination throughout the year, the stunning mountain range of Serra da Estrela is located in central Portugal. This beautiful region is ideal for hiking and paragliding during the summer, and skiing during the winter months.

The protected Serra da Estela Natural Park features striking rivers, rolling hills, imposing mountains, water springs, green valleys and Portugal’s only ski resort. The highest pick of the Portuguese mainland is called Torre and is reachable by car.

Situated in the foothills of Serra de Estrela, the charming village of Linhares has cobbled streets, traditional stone houses and the majestic castle towers of Linhares da Beira. The town of Guarda is the highest in Portugal and home to a gorgeous 14th-century Gothic cathedral. Wander around the small streets, admire the picturesque granite houses and savour regional soft cheese.

Located in the centre of Portugal, the modern city of Covilhã has a variety of shops, restaurants and outdoor activities. The University of Beira Interior is one of the most important in Portugal.

    Unhais da Serra is a very small town.

    Unhais da Serra is a very small town. It has one outstanding restaurant - As Thermas and another couple of ones that are good options as well. A couple of local shops that carry the delicious cheeses, charcuterie and liquors made in Serra da Estrela. We always stop to replenish or stock - we prefer the tiny mini-market, but the fancier shop has sweatshirts, slippers and interesting items as well. It's the perfect get-away for rest and relaxation. We park the car at the H2otel and do walking to everywhere we need to go over the weekend. I'd say a 3-4 night stay is ideal.

    Loriga is a gorgeous town, not unlike many in the area of...

    Loriga is a gorgeous town, not unlike many in the area of the Serra da Estrela. What sets it apart is a great river beach (praia fluvial); its closeness to the Parque da Serra da Estrela, an easy 20-minute drive; and it's less busy than other more popular towns. Driving through Loriga's streets can be a daunting experience if you are not used to very narrow streets and steep slopes. If you plan on staying try to find lodging close to the main road.
